Fast-forward to March, a new school-term is underway, but during the 2019 third-term holidays, we had had meetings with parents of children who are sponsored by you, our partners. The children were not performing to the standard we desired, partly because their parents (mostly illiterate), though willing were unable to help with home-work and basic coaching and mentorship from home.
The parents agreed to our proposal to have their children at the Deliverance Church premises after-school hours thrice each week. We sent out a call, and the volunteers came to our rescue. Theirs was to coach, and mentor both in academics and Godly principles.

That too commenced, and one of our volunteers, Ahebwa Isaac Nabimanya said, "The Experience has been very interesting . The children have made me recall things I last read in 2015. I've shown them some things but they have also reminded me of a lot."

With the outbreak of the Corona Virus pandemic, first in the world and later making its way to Uganda, the team at Pendeza Uganda faced a new challenge, an unforeseen one at that. Like many law-abiding organisations, we followed the Government's directives and regulations given by the ministry of Health.

Everyone entering our premises had to have their hands sanitized. Standard operating procedures were adhered to, and physical cash handled with utmost caution.

When the Lock Down was first introduced, we needed to make adjustments. We couldn't do business as usual. Our financial services could go on through our Mobile Money, and banking. By this time, a lot of our planned work with the community and children had already been halted, but we had a new challenge.

Given the economic status of the majority of our clients, a lock-down meant they could not carryout their day-to-day  money-making ventures smoothly and their incomes were affected. Because many live from hand-to-mouth, food and basic hygiene items like soap were things they needed but could not afford. A call was made and through the support of the Deliverance Church family and other networks, we secured food which was delivered and distributed to the community. This was under a campaign that was dubbed, The Food Basket Campaign.
As at the time of sending this Newsletter, upto over 450 Food Baskets have been distributed and we are grateful to have been a part of this.
